Description:

Description for Gite

Each deposit offers a spacious area of 130 square meters. The living room is generously sized at 40 square meters and includes a lounge area with a sofa bed and a pull-out bed. A cozy stove is available, with wood provided, along with central heating for added comfort. There are two toilets, a shower room, and a fully-equipped kitchen. The deposit comprises three bedrooms, including one with a 140-sized bed, another with four 90-sized beds, and a third with an 80-sized bed. Additionally, each cottage features an enclosed courtyard at the front.

Attractions

  • Château de Rochefort: Located in the village of St Didier Sur Rochefort, this medieval castle offers a glimpse into the region's rich history. Explore the well-preserved architecture, admire the scenic surroundings, and learn about the castle's fascinating past.
  • Lac de Villerest: Situated just a short distance from Grand Ris, Lac de Villerest is a picturesque reservoir perfect for nature lovers. Enjoy a peaceful walk along the lakeside, go fishing, or rent a boat to explore the tranquil waters.
  • Roche-en-Régnier: This charming village, located nearby, is known for its stunning natural setting. Take a leisurely stroll through its quaint streets, visit the historic church, and en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ding hills and the Loire River.
  • Château de La Roche: Nestled on a rocky outcrop overlooking the Loire River, Château de La Roche is a captivating medieval fortress. Discover its well-preserved architecture, explore the castle's rooms, and enjoy panoramic views from its towers.
  • Sainte-Croix-en-Jarez: A former Carthusian monastery turned village, Sainte-Croix-en-Jarez is a unique attraction. Wander through its well-preserved medieval streets, visit the museum showcasing the monastery's history, and appreciate the peaceful atmosphere.
  • Les Gorges de la Loire: Explore the stunning natural beauty of the Loire River Gorges, located in the vicinity. Hike along the scenic trails, admire the impressive cliffs, and marvel at the picturesque views of the river winding through the landscape.
  • Musée de la Fourme et des Traditions: Located in the nearby town of Saint-Bonnet-le-Château, this museum is dedicated to the history and production of Fourme de Montbrison, a famous local cheese. Learn about the cheese-making process, sample different varieties, and discover the traditions associated with it.
  • Le Puy-en-Velay: Situated around 40 kilometers from Grand Ris, Le Puy-en-Velay is a historic town known for its distinctive volcanic landscape and religious heritage. Visit the iconic Notre-Dame du Puy Cathedral, explore the old town's narrow streets, and climb the Rocher Corneille for panoramic views.
  • Château de Couzan: Located in the nearby village of Sail-sous-Couzan, Château de Couzan is a medieval castle perched on a rocky hilltop. Discover its defensive architecture, explore the castle's interior, and enjoy bre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. 10. Montbrison: This charming town, located around 25 kilometers away, offers a mix of historical and cultural attractions. Visit the medieval Château de Montbrison, stroll through the picturesque old town, and explore the various shops and restaurants offering local specialties.
